🚨 Mortgage Rates Rise Today! 🚨

Mortgage rates went up today, not because of losses in the stock market, but due to rising bond yields. 📈 The market is signaling that inflation is expected to increase, leading to a higher interest rate environment instead of easing credit policies.

If inflation rises while the economy struggles, we could be heading toward stagflation—a challenging scenario where inflation stays high, but economic growth stagnates. Stay tuned and be mindful of how these shifts may affect your financial decisions! 💡💰

The Los Angeles fires are exposing some things to be aware of regarding your property Insurance policies.

If property is in trust, please make sure the insurance policy is also under the name of your trust. Some insurance claims are in dispute of being covered or have been denied because insurance was under individual homeowner’s name(s) while title was held in the trust.

“Yes, a carrier can potentially deny a claim if the home is titled in a trust or LLC but the insurance policy is under the individual homeowner's name. This is because the ownership structure as indicated on the title must match the named insured on the policy to ensure proper coverage. To avoid a dispute or denial of claim it's crucial to add the trust or LLC as an additional insured on the policy.”
